Auto heated seats/steering wheel can be coded without ConnectedDrive subscription
When my ConnectedDrive subscription expired, the only feature I missed was the "Climate control rules". Loved how my hands and butt were always warm in the cold Canadian weather without me worrying about anything.
After a bit of search on this forum, I managed to code the feature back! Credits to Trojanlaw for sharing the info. Now they are under "Seat and armrest heating" rather than "Climate control rules" but the functionality are exactly the same and I have it for all four seats (it detects if a person is sitting there too)! |

Just to emphasize the totally obvious: the fact that these settings are able to be enabled locally, without any active online subscription service, proves conclusively that there's no technical or functional reason whatsoever that they imply any ongoing cost whatsoever for BMW, and shutting them off unless the customer pays the ongoing extortion fee to BMW is pure and unadulterated corporate greed.
This is in contrast to, for example, the real-time traffic information service, which probably has some marginal ongoing cost for BMW to provide, so at least in concept there's some rational justification for passing the ongoing costs along to the consumer, to continue using the feature. Gating this feature behind the subscription service is just pure, disgusting, contemptable greed and customer-hostile product design (and dishonest product feature descriptions and marketing, as a cherry on top).
